Investment
Add: - utils/pickFile: pilih extention file sesuai kebutuhan - utils/formatCurrencyDisplay.ts: tampillan uang 2.500 - api-client/api-investment.ts - api-storage.ts: api strogre wibudev Fix: - Integrasi API pada: Create, Edit, Tampilan status & detail - Button status dan hapus data juga sudah terintegrasi ### No Issue
This commit is contained in:
@@ -10,26 +10,32 @@ import Investment_ButtonStatusSection from "./ButtonStatusSection";
|
||||
|
||||
export default function Invesment_DetailDataPublishSection({
|
||||
status,
|
||||
data,
|
||||
bottomSection,
|
||||
buttonSection,
|
||||
}: {
|
||||
status: string;
|
||||
data: any;
|
||||
bottomSection?: React.ReactNode;
|
||||
buttonSection?: React.ReactNode;
|
||||
}) {
|
||||
// console.log("[DATA DETAIL]", JSON.stringify(data, null, 2));
|
||||
return (
|
||||
<>
|
||||
<StackCustom gap={"sm"}>
|
||||
<Invesment_BoxProgressSection status={status as string} />
|
||||
<Invesment_BoxDetailDataSection
|
||||
title={data?.title}
|
||||
imageId={data?.imageId}
|
||||
data={
|
||||
status === "publish"
|
||||
? listDataPublishInvesment
|
||||
: listDataNotPublishInvesment
|
||||
? listDataPublishInvesment({ data })
|
||||
: listDataNotPublishInvesment({ data })
|
||||
}
|
||||
bottomSection={bottomSection}
|
||||
/>
|
||||
<Investment_ButtonStatusSection
|
||||
id={data?.id}
|
||||
status={status as string}
|
||||
buttonPublish={buttonSection}
|
||||
/>
|
||||
|
||||
Reference in New Issue
Block a user